El Niño 81% Likely to Peak at Highest Level; Brazilian Firms Urged to Shift to Adaptation
Valor Econômico·BR · US·about 10 hours ago
NOAA projects a more than 90% probability that El Niño will intensify to a very strong event during the 2026–27 boreal fall and winter, potentially rivaling historical records. The forecast implies elevated risks of extreme rainfall, drought, and temperature anomalies across multiple regions, with implications for agriculture, energy demand, and disaster preparedness. Uncertainty remains over the exact peak intensity and regional impacts, which will depend on evolving ocean-atmosphere coupling.
